It has been reported that doctors can now stop giving life-sustaining treatment to a 24-year-old dad who has been in a coma for two years.A judge ruled last Wednesday that Marcus Campbell, of Thornton Heath, can be moved onto a palliative care regime.The dad-of-two, who is being cared for at Croydon University Hospital (CUH), fell into a coma after suffering a rare inflammation of his brain stem in 2014.Family and friends staged two days of protest at CUH in October 2014 and launched a campaign...
